タグ

関連タグで絞り込む (0)

  • 関連タグはありません

タグの絞り込みを解除

javaScriptとqiitaとfluxに関するkyo_agoのブックマーク (2)

  • Reduxのmiddlewareを積極的に使っていく - Qiita

    最初はちょっととっつきにくいけど、責務がはっきり分かれていて比較的コードがごちゃごちゃになりにくい(と思っている)Reduxですが、やはり実戦投入するとどうにも扱いにくい部分が出てきます。 特にそう感じるのは通信系の処理、ユーザーとのインタラクションです。これってつまるところ非同期処理なんですが、処理を依頼する側、つまりActionを投げる側としては「あとのことはまかせた!」と言いたい。Actionを投げる部分ってのはだいたい何かのイベントハンドラだったりしますが、そういう場所に通信やインタラクションの処理をダラダラと書きたくない。 稿ではそれらの面倒な部分を責務が分離されたメンテナンスのしやすいコードになるようにmiddlewareを活用する例をいくつか紹介します。 その前にmiddlewareについて Reduxの公式ドキュメントではログ出力を例に取り、アプリケーション体から分離し

    Reduxのmiddlewareを積極的に使っていく - Qiita
  • HaxeとReact - Qiita

    HaxeからJavaScriptを出力するというのは、静的型付き言語が好きだとか、JavaScriptはそれほど好きではないがWebコンテンツは作りたいという人にはとても良い選択肢だと思います。 とはいえ、HaxeはTypeScriptほどJavaScriptに近くないので、HaxeとJavaScriptライブラリの相性というのはとても悩ましい問題です。jQueryを使うとHaxeを使ううまみが減るとか、変数名に"$"が使えないのでAngularJSが使えないだとか、そういったことです。 悩んだ結果、Dynamic型やuntypedキーワードを使って動的言語的な書き方をしてライブラリを使うか、もうJS製のライブラリを使うのをあきらめてgetElementByIdべた書きで頑張るとか、そういった選択を迫られてきました。 では今、流行りのReactの場合はどうでしょう? 実際につかってみた感想

    HaxeとReact - Qiita
  • 1